VerbalJint’s Agency Clarifies His Dating Rumors With BraveGirls’ Minyoung
On April 24, STARNEWS reported that Minyoung and Verbal Jint are dating.
In response to the report, a representative of Verbal Jint’s agency OTHERSIDE clarified, “The two were seeing each other before, but they broke up.” Verbal Jint and Minyoung were reported to have dated for two years. It was also reported that Minyoung participated in the production of the songs “Walking” and “Dark Side” from Verbal Jint’s seventh studio album “Outro” under the pseudonym Kkodooramyi and also featured in the song “Walking” under the name Isobel Kim. Kkodooramyi’s real name registered in the Korea Music Copyright Association is Kim Min Young .
